接下來 , 你要到;Dave;Campbell;的網(wǎng)站取得驅(qū)動程式的原始程式碼;(;http://www.torque.net/~campbell/imm.tar.gz) 。0.18;版是在寫這份文件時(Aug.;"98)的最新版本[譯者注] 。將檔案解壓縮到某目錄下(例如解到;/usr/src;下面) 。接下來執(zhí)行;make 。你就會得到;imm;驅(qū)動程式模組(imm.o) 。將該模組復(fù)制到;
/lib/modules/$(uname;-r)/scsi
下 。;
[譯者注];在我翻譯這篇;mini-Howto;時(Jun.;1999) , 最新的版本仍是;0.18;版 。;
如果你已經(jīng)載入;lp;模組(可以使用;lsmod(1);命令檢查) , 先卸除;lp;模組(rmmod;lp) , 然後載入;imm.o;模組(insmod;imm) 。到這里 , 你已經(jīng)完成了基本的設(shè)定 。;
如果你在載入;imm;模組時 , ;ZIP;磁碟機(jī)并沒有連接好或者沒有打開電源 , 你會看到;"init_module:;Device;or;resource;busy";的錯誤訊息 , 而無法載入模組 。(附帶一提 , 當(dāng)你要連接;ZIP;磁碟機(jī)到電腦主機(jī)時 , 似乎不需要將電腦關(guān)機(jī);--;只要確定;imm;模組沒有載入 , 而且磁碟機(jī)的電源是關(guān)的 , 接著只要將電纜線插好 , 打開電源 , 并載入模組就可以了 。);
如果;ZIP;磁碟機(jī)已經(jīng)接好而且也打開電源了 , 但是沒有插磁片在里面 , 那麼;imm;模組還是會載入 , 但是你會看到無法讀取磁碟分割表的錯誤訊息 。這沒關(guān)系 , 因為當(dāng)你在磁碟機(jī)內(nèi)插入磁片 , 系統(tǒng)會自動讀取分割表 。;
若你在載入模組時 , ZIP;磁碟機(jī)內(nèi)有插磁片 , 那你會看到該磁片的分割區(qū)列表以及寫入保護(hù)狀態(tài)等等的完整資訊 。下面是一個載入模組時所看到的磁片資訊的例子:;
vger:~#;insmod;imm
imm:;Version;0.18
imm:;Probing;port;03bc
imm:;Probing;port;0378
imm:;;;;;SPP;port;present
imm:;;;;;ECP;with;a;16;byte;FIFO;present
imm:;;;;;PS/2;bidirectional;port;present
imm:;;;;;Passed;Intel;bug;check.
imm:;Probing;port;0278
scsi0;:;Iomega;ZIP;Plus;drive
scsi;:;1;host.
Vendor:;IOMEGA;;;;Model:;ZIP;100;PLUS;;;;;;Rev:;J.66
Type:;;;Direct-Access;;;;;;ANSI;SCSI;revision:;02
Detected;scsi;removable;disk;sda;at;scsi0,;channel;0,;id;6,;lun;0
SCSI;device;sda:;hdwr;sector=;512;bytes.;Sectors=;196608;[96;MB];[0.1;GB]
sda:;Write;Protect;is;off
sda:;sda1
vger:~#
最後值得一提的是 , 當(dāng)磁片被掛載以後 , 這版的驅(qū)動程式會將磁片鎖住 。如果在這時按下退片鈕 , 磁片并不會退出來 , 但是磁碟機(jī)會『記得』你的退片要求 , 并在你卸載(umount)磁片後立刻退片 。;
4.5;ATAPI;版本;
有關(guān)這種機(jī)型的資訊可以在這里找到:;http://www.iomega.com/zip/products/insider.html
之前有一小段時間還有一種;IDE;版本的磁碟機(jī) 。不過我想現(xiàn)在絕大部分都已經(jīng)被;ATAPI;版本的機(jī)器所取代 。;
Donald;Stidwell;提供我下面這些有關(guān);ATAPI;版本的說明 。謝謝;Don 。;
我有一臺;ATAPI;ZIP;磁碟機(jī) , 而且在;2.0.32;及;2.0.33;版的核心下都能正常運(yùn)作 。我在;RH;5.0;及;OpenLinux;1.2;(我現(xiàn)在在使用的發(fā)行版本)下都測試過[譯者注] 。我所需要做的只是開啟;ATAPI;floppy;support;的核心組態(tài)設(shè)定 。OpenLinux;的核心并沒有內(nèi)定開啟這個功能 。;
[譯者注];我本身在;Slackware;3.3/3.6;以及;RedHat;5.2;下都能正常使用;ATAPI;ZIP , 測試過的核心版本有;2.0.35,;2.0.36,;2.2.1,;2.2.2;等 。;
不需要其他額外的驅(qū)動程式 。ZIP;磁片會以延伸分割區(qū)(Extended;Partition)的形式掛載在第;4;個分割區(qū) 。例如 , 我的狀況是掛載;HDB4 。我以;noauto;的掛載選項將;ZIP;磁片掛載於;/mnt/zip , 但是我想用自動掛載應(yīng)該也不會有問題 。我想唯一可能的問題是退片 。我總是在要退片前 , 先卸載磁片 。;
在;1998;年五月號的;Linux;Gazette;中 , 有對於在;Linux;下安裝;ATAPI;ZIP;的更詳細(xì)介紹 。請參考;2;cent;tip;的部分 。;
推薦閱讀
- Jaz-drive HOWTO -- 4. Jaz 磁片的用法
- Jaz-drive HOWTO -- 5. Linux 上的 Jaz 工具軟件
- Jaz-drive HOWTO -- 6. 從 Jaz 磁片啟動系統(tǒng)
- Jaz-drive HOWTO -- 1. 導(dǎo)言
- Jaz-drive HOWTO -- 2. Jaz 磁碟機(jī)的硬件
- Jaz-drive HOWTO -- 3. 電腦確認(rèn)已安裝 Jaz 磁碟機(jī)
- Soundblaster 16 PnP Mini-Howto 如何在Linux設(shè)定16位P
- 新聞 Leafsite mini-HOWTO
- 使用LILO做為Win95+WinNT+Linux多重開機(jī) mini-HOWTO
- LINUX modules 模塊安裝 MINI-HOWTO
